Cheat Sheet

  1. The 22 Letters and Their Order -

    Review the sequence from Alef to Tav by using a mnemonic like "Aunt Beth Can Drive Every Friday…Zany Tavern" to anchor each first letter in a fun phrase. Consistent practice reciting the sequence aloud builds automatic recall, a tip recommended by Hebrew University's language labs. Mastering this order lays the groundwork for any hebrew alphabet quiz.

  2. Letter Shapes and Final Forms -

    Hebrew has five letters with special end-of-word shapes (Kaf, Mem, Nun, Pe, Tsadi); practice writing each in its regular and final form side by side. The University of Haifa's writing center suggests tracing templates to internalize the subtle strokes and angles. Recognizing these forms quickly is key to acing the Hebrew letters quiz.

  3. Consonant Groupings by Sound -

    Group letters by shared features, such as gutturals (ם, ה, ח) or labials (ב, פ, מ), to streamline memorization and pronunciation. Studies from Ben-Gurion University highlight that clustering similar sounds accelerates learning and retention.   4. Niqqud Vowel Marks -

    Although the quiz focuses on consonants, knowing key niqqud (vowel marks) like kamatz (ָ) and patach (ַ) sharpens your reading and letter recognition skills. The Academy of the Hebrew Language provides clear charts for each mark's position and pronunciation. Familiarity with niqqud complements your hebrew alphabet practice by boosting reading speed and accuracy.

  5. Gematria: Numerical Values -

    Each letter carries a numeric value (Alef=1, Bet=2…Tav=400) used in everything from dates to puzzles; create flashcards to quiz yourself on these values. Research from Bar-Ilan University shows that linking letters to numbers enhances cognitive mapping of the alphabet.
